Background and Career

Sophia Kylie Umansky was born on January 18, 2000, in Los Angeles, California. Raised in a household renowned for its reality TV fame - thanks in large part to her mother's role on The Real Housewives of Beverly Hills - Sophia has effortlessly adapted to the limelight [source]. She graduated with a degree in psychology from George Washington University in 2022, a milestone celebrated publicly by her family. Joining The Agency

Inspired by her father Mauricio Umansky, CEO of The Agency, Sophia joined the family business shortly after her graduation. The Umansky Team, known for their integrity and success, is a top performer in luxury real estate. Sophia brings a fresh perspective, leveraging her psychological insights to refine client experiences. Her role on [source], Netflix's Buying Beverly Hills, further exemplifies her dual capabilities in real estate and media.
